pub(crate) fn decode_sample<E: Endpoint>(sample: &Sample, topic: &str) -> Result<(E, BusMetadata)> {
decode_payload::<E>(sample, topic)
}
pub(crate) fn decode_payload<B: Payload>(sample: &Sample, topic: &str) -> Result<(B, BusMetadata)> {
let malformed = |problem: MetadataProblem| BusError::metadata(topic, problem);
let encoding: EncodingMetadata = sample
.encoding()
.to_string()
.parse()
.map_err(|e: EncodingError| malformed(e.into()))?;
if encoding.codec_id() != Some(CodecId::MessagePack) {
return Err(BusError::UnsupportedCodec {
codec: encoding.codec,
topic: topic.to_string(),
});
}
let attachment = sample
.attachment()
.ok_or_else(|| malformed(MetadataProblem::MissingAttachment))?;
let metadata =
BusMetadata::decode(attachment.to_bytes().as_ref()).map_err(|e| malformed(e.into()))?;
if metadata.codec != encoding.codec {
return Err(malformed(MetadataProblem::CodecMismatch {
encoding: encoding.codec,
attachment: metadata.codec,
}));
}
if metadata.codec_id() != Some(CodecId::MessagePack) {
return Err(BusError::UnsupportedCodec {
codec: metadata.codec,
topic: topic.to_string(),
});
}
let body = MessagePack::decode::<B>(sample.payload().to_bytes().as_ref())?;
Ok((body, metadata))
}
